Buying Guide for the Best Budget Phones

When it comes to buying a budget phone, it's important to find a balance between cost and functionality. Budget phones have come a long way and now offer many features that were once only available in high-end models. To make the best choice, you need to consider several key specifications that will impact your overall experience. Understanding these specs will help you find a phone that meets your needs without breaking the bank.
DisplayThe display is the screen of the phone where you view all your content. It's important because it's the primary way you interact with your device. Budget phones typically come with LCD or OLED displays. LCDs are more common and generally cheaper, but OLEDs offer better color and contrast. Screen resolution is also crucial; higher resolutions like Full HD (1080p) provide clearer and sharper images compared to HD (720p). If you watch a lot of videos or play games, a higher resolution and better display type will enhance your experience.
Battery LifeBattery life determines how long your phone can operate before needing a recharge. This is especially important if you're frequently on the go. Battery capacity is measured in milliampere-hours (mAh). Phones with larger batteries (around 4000mAh or more) tend to last longer. However, battery life also depends on other factors like screen size, resolution, and processor efficiency. If you use your phone heavily for activities like gaming or streaming, opt for a higher capacity battery.
Camera QualityThe camera quality is crucial if you enjoy taking photos and videos. Budget phones now often come with multiple cameras, including wide-angle and macro lenses. The main camera's megapixel count is important, but it's not the only factor; sensor quality and software optimization also play significant roles. For casual photography, a phone with a 12-16MP camera should suffice. If you want better photo quality, look for features like night mode, image stabilization, and higher megapixel counts.
ProcessorThe processor, or CPU, is the brain of the phone and affects its overall performance. Budget phones usually come with mid-range processors that are sufficient for everyday tasks like browsing, social media, and light gaming. Popular budget processors include Qualcomm Snapdragon 600 series and MediaTek Helio series. If you plan to use your phone for more demanding applications, look for a phone with a slightly more powerful processor within the budget range.
StorageStorage capacity determines how much data you can keep on your phone, including apps, photos, and videos. Budget phones typically offer 32GB to 64GB of internal storage. If you store a lot of media or install many apps, you might need more storage. Some budget phones also offer expandable storage via microSD cards, which can be a cost-effective way to increase capacity. Consider your usage habits to decide how much storage you need.
Build QualityBuild quality refers to the materials and construction of the phone. While budget phones often use plastic rather than metal or glass, many still offer solid build quality. A well-built phone will feel sturdy and last longer. Look for features like Gorilla Glass for screen protection and water resistance, which can add to the phone's durability. If you tend to be rough on your devices, prioritize build quality to ensure your phone can withstand daily wear and tear.
Software and UpdatesThe software experience and update policy are important for the phone's longevity and security. Budget phones often come with Android, and the user experience can vary based on the manufacturer’s customizations. Some brands are better at providing regular software updates, which can improve performance and security over time. Check the manufacturer’s track record for updates and consider phones that come with the latest version of the operating system for the best experience.
